The Ministry of External Affairs of India (MEA) is the central government agency tasked with managing India's foreign relations and advancing the nation's diplomatic interests globally. For aspirants preparing for UPSC, SSC, and other government exams, understanding the MEA is vital as it represents India on the international stage, safeguarding national interests and fostering global cooperation. This ministry offers prestigious government jobs through Ministry of External Affairs recruitment drives, including roles for diplomats, analysts, and administrative staff via the Union Public Service Commission (UPSC) and SSC exams.
MEA plays a crucial role in public welfare by coordinating international aid, protecting Indian citizens abroad, and contributing to national development through strategic partnerships.
